Shouldn't the hpgps ntp driver wait to raise the leap second flag until
a month before the leap second and not whenever the satellite happens
to first transmit it? See attached patch.
diff -u refclock_hpgps.c.orig refclock_hpgps.c
--- refclock_hpgps.c.orig 2008-08-25 09:49:59.000000000 -0500
+++ refclock_hpgps.c 2008-08-25 09:56:29.000000000 -0500
@@ -535,7 +535,8 @@
switch (leapchar) {
case '+':
- pp->leap = LEAP_ADDSECOND;
+ if ((month == 6) || (month == 12))
+ pp->leap = LEAP_ADDSECOND;
break;
case '0':
@@ -543,7 +544,8 @@
break;
case '-':
- pp->leap = LEAP_DELSECOND;
+ if ((month == 6) || (month == 12))
+ pp->leap = LEAP_DELSECOND;
break;
default:
